Forward Collision Avoidance Warnings Issues in the 2022 CHEVROLET BOLT EUV

2 forward collision avoidance warnings complaints have been filed with NHTSA for the 2022 CHEVROLET BOLT EUV. Of these, 0 involved a crash, 0 involved a fire, and 0 resulted in injury.

#11676189 |
Three times while using the Adaptive Cruise Control, the car applied the brakes without cause (“phantom braking”.) Two of the times there were cars behind me that could have rear ended me given the unexpected, rapid deceleration. The problem has not been reviewed by the car dealer (because they won’t return my calls.). No other parties have inspected. No warning lamps or messages. Incident dates: 5/9/2025, 6/22/2025, and 7/19/2025.
#11623961 |
I was driving home on the highway a few days ago I had just picked up my daughter from school as usual. My chevy braked on the with no vehicle in the front only one in the rear. The car breaked so hard it nearly stopped and the car behind swerved out of the way.
